Welcome from our principal

Welcome to Lane Cove West Public School!

Nestled among trees and wildlife on Sydney’s North Shore, our school of 474 students offers a warm, inclusive community where every child is supported to reach their potential. We aim to prepare lifelong learners and responsible global citizens through a strong focus on literacy, numeracy, science, arts, and sport.

Supported by our parent community, our dedicated staff provide engaging, challenging learning experiences, while our dynamic extracurricular programs let students explore their talents. With excellent facilities such as our state of the art STEM room, incredible new playground and sandpit, and unique features like therapy dogs, resident chickens, vegetable gardens, and a fish pond, students connect deeply with our school life.

We nurture academic success, wellbeing, and our values of responsibility, respect, and endeavour. I warmly invite you to explore our website and learn more about how we can support your child's journey of growth and discovery.

Roslyn Gee

Relieving Principal
